Output 5d8d0c4ae2b9331ecaeeabd6bcab8af011894869a1e12daabe525dbd44f642bd: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4ecfa2f6b4babd0e004b40602a17f4415286597 OP_EQUAL
address
3KeGFcWRMnKTKV1YGXco98Bu4jDd7WvdkG
transaction
5d8d0c4ae2b9331ecaeeabd6bcab8af011894869a1e12daabe525dbd44f642bd
confirmations
1013
spent
true